Abstract :
We fabricated highly tilted fiber gratings and demonstrated that the broad-band polarization-dependent loss (PDL) of the gratings may be tuned by twisting the fiber along the length of the grating. We show that the PDL for a given twist angle can be determined from a simple Jones matrix calculation which can also take into account birefringence on the PDL axis. We combine the twisted-tilted grating with a polarization controller to form a PDL compensator and use it to minimize the polarization-dependent responsivity of a nonlinear silicon avalanche photodiode.
